Britney Spears in the Spotlight

Is She the Worst Mom Ever or is it Just All the Media Coverage?

Katelyn Thomas
I've seen so many people bashing Britney Spears for being crazy and a bad mother lately. The news media is having a field day with all the nutty stuff she is doing and chronicling her deteriorating condition. It is sad to see someone fall apart like this and sad her children are losing their mother because of her own self destructive behavior. However, I think the true tragedy here is that shock at her actions and the reaction of child services, etc. stems from her celebrity status. Children all over the USA are in conditions just as bad, but their parents aren't in the spotlight. Is Britney Spears unfit to care for her children in her present condition? Absolutely. Is she the worst mom on earth? Sadly, no.

5. Drinking and doing drugs in front of her children is unexcusable. Unfortunately, the number of moms who are high as a kite and still have custody of their children breaks my heart. Why are the kids still there? The system is only as good as the resources given to the people who staff it. Overburdened social workers, foster homes bursting at the seams and a desire to avoid damaging children by pulling them out of their homes if parents can be rehabilitated all work against even the most passionate child's rights advocate.

What can we do about Britney Spears and her children? The best thing for now is probably exactly what has happened. Kevin Federline says he cleaned up his act. I sincerely hope it is true and I hope Britney can concentrate on doing the same thing since she doesn't have anyone to care for but herself now. However, there is something we can do for the children that aren't in the spotlight. If you have empty bedrooms, do foster care. If not, try a Big Brother or Big Sister program.
